Output 3095f87231685c9a03509fda03fcc893ef67082352d569577cbbc9f172d45dd4:0

value
509809
script pubkey
OP_0 OP_PUSHBYTES_20 5de5721bc645b225167c175a3b0f6b264e22657e
address
ltc1qthjhyx7xgkez29nuzadrkrmtye8zyet78nrahf
transaction
3095f87231685c9a03509fda03fcc893ef67082352d569577cbbc9f172d45dd4
spent
false